#include <stdio.h>
#include <stdlib.h>
#include <string.h>
#include <math.h>
#include <limits.h>
#include <bits/stdc++.h>
#include <memory.h>
  
typedef long long ll;
typedef unsigned long long llu;
typedef double lf;
typedef long double llf;
typedef unsigned int uint;
  
using namespace std;
  
const int N_ = 100500, K_ = 205;
int N, K, A[N_];
ll Table[2][N_], S[N_];
int opt[K_][N_];
  
void solve (int k, int i) {
    if(k == 1) return;
    solve(k - 1, opt[k][i] - 1);
    printf("%d ", opt[k][i] - 1);
}
 
ll *now, *prev;
 
void conq (int k, int l, int r, int optl, int optr) {
  int m = (l+r) >> 1;
  for(int j = optl; j <= optr && j <= m; j++) {
    ll val = prev[j-1] + (S[m] - S[j-1]) * (S[N] - S[m]);
    if(val >= now[m]) now[m] = val, opt[k][m] = j;
  }
  if(l < r) {
    conq (k, l, m-1, optl, opt[k][m]);
    conq (k, m+1, r, opt[k][m], optr);
  }
}
  
int main() {
    scanf("%d%d", &N, &K);
    for(int i = 1; i <= N; i++) scanf("%d", A+i), S[i] = S[i-1] + A[i];
  
    for(int i = 1; i <= N; i++) Table[1][i] = S[i] * (S[N] - S[i]);
    for(int k = 2; k <= K+1; k++) {
        now = Table[k&1], prev = Table[~k&1];
        for(int i = 1; i <= N; i++) now[i] = -1, opt[k][i] = -1;
        conq(k, k, N, k, N);
    }
  
    printf("%lld\n", Table[~K&1][N]);
    solve(K+1, N);
  
    return 0;
}
